Dovecot Configuration: Frequent Problems and Workarounds
Successfully installing Dovecot can sometimes involve a few challenges . A frequent issue is misconfigured file access rights , often resulting in “connection refused” indications. Verify that the Dovecot data location and associated files are owned by the correct user, typically vmail user, and have the appropriate read and write access. Another challenge arises when the SSL/TLS keys are missing . Meticulously check your certificate chain here and confirm that the paths specified in Dovecot’s setup are correct . Finally, firewall limitations can prevent connections; examine your firewall configuration to allow traffic on the required ports (typically 143 for IMAP and 993 for IMAP over SSL/TLS, and 995 for POP3 over SSL/TLS).
